Senior Corporate Life Servicing Officer

Location: Nairobi, Kenya
Date Posted: 29 October 2025

The Senior Corporate Life Servicing Officer will be responsible for the efficient management and administration of corporate life policies. This position requires a meticulous individual who can ensure timely policy servicing, maintain client satisfaction, and uphold compliance with internal procedures and regulatory standards.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Manage and oversee all aspects of corporate life policy servicing, including policy issuance, renewals, endorsements, and premium reconciliation.
  • Ensure that all corporate life policy records are accurate, complete, and updated in the system.
  • Coordinate with underwriting and finance departments to ensure seamless policy management and correct application of premiums and benefits.
  • Handle client queries and provide professional and timely responses to ensure client satisfaction.
  • Prepare and analyze monthly reports on policy performance and servicing metrics.
  • Support corporate clients during policy renewals by providing updated information, facilitating smooth renewal processes, and maintaining strong relationships with intermediaries and brokers.
  • Review and verify all policy-related documents to ensure accuracy and compliance with internal controls.
  • Ensure that all servicing activities adhere to company policies, regulatory guidelines, and service level agreements.
  • Train and mentor junior officers in policy servicing procedures and best practices.

This position demands a high level of organization, analytical skills, and the ability to work collaboratively with internal teams and external stakeholders.

Senior Legal Claims Officer

Location: Nairobi, Kenya
Date Posted: 28 October 2025

The Senior Legal Claims Officer will be responsible for managing and overseeing the legal aspects of claims handling, particularly those involving litigation or complex liability issues. The role involves providing legal expertise in the assessment, negotiation, and settlement of claims to safeguard the organization’s interests while ensuring fair treatment of clients.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Manage all legal claims and ensure timely resolution of cases, including those referred to external legal counsel.
  • Analyze claim documents, legal reports, and supporting evidence to determine liability and recommend appropriate settlements.
  • Advise management on potential legal risks associated with claims and recommend mitigation strategies.
  • Liaise with external advocates, assessors, and investigators to ensure that all legal claims are handled effectively and efficiently.
  • Review pleadings, witness statements, and other legal documents to ensure consistency and accuracy.
  • Participate in case conferences and provide regular updates to management on the progress and status of legal claims.
  • Oversee and manage the claims litigation portfolio, ensuring adherence to internal policies and regulatory compliance.
  • Prepare detailed reports on claim trends, emerging legal risks, and recovery opportunities.
  • Support the implementation of strategies to reduce litigation exposure and promote alternative dispute resolution where appropriate.
  • Supervise and provide guidance to junior officers in the legal claims unit.

This position requires excellent analytical and negotiation skills, a sound understanding of insurance law, and the ability to balance organizational and client interests in the claims resolution process.

Counter Fraud Officer (4 Months Fixed-Term Contract)

Location: Nairobi, Kenya
Date Posted: 30 October 2025

The Counter Fraud Officer will be responsible for identifying, investigating, and preventing fraudulent activities within the organization’s operations. The position is a fixed-term contract role designed to strengthen internal fraud control measures and promote an ethical working environment.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Conduct thorough investigations into suspected fraud cases related to claims, underwriting, or policy servicing.
  • Collect, analyze, and preserve evidence to support fraud detection and prosecution processes.
  • Develop and implement proactive measures to detect potential fraud risks across various operational units.
  • Collaborate with internal departments, law enforcement agencies, and external investigators in handling fraud-related cases.
  • Prepare comprehensive investigation reports with findings and recommendations for management action.
  • Support the implementation of fraud prevention strategies and awareness initiatives within the organization.
  • Monitor transactional data to identify irregularities, patterns, or inconsistencies that could indicate fraudulent behavior.
  • Maintain accurate records of all fraud investigations and ensure confidentiality of information.
  • Provide input into policy and procedural reviews to strengthen internal controls against fraud.
  • Conduct staff sensitization sessions on fraud awareness and ethical conduct.

This position requires a strong sense of integrity, analytical thinking, and the ability to handle sensitive information with discretion and professionalism.
